Exploring Hayward on a Budget
Saving money while exploring a new city is always a smart move. Here are some free or low-cost attractions in Hayward that you can enjoy without breaking the bank:
1. Hayward Japanese Gardens:Take a leisurely stroll through the beautiful Hayward Japanese Gardens located on the campus of California State University, East Bay. Enjoy the serene surroundings, koi ponds, and traditional Japanese landscaping for free.
2. Hayward Farmers' Market:Visit the Hayward Farmers' Market to experience local produce, artisanal goods, and a vibrant community atmosphere. Entrance is free, and you can sample fresh fruits, vegetables, and baked goods without spending much.
3. Garin Regional Park:Explore the great outdoors at Garin Regional Park for a nominal parking fee. Enjoy hiking trails, picnic areas, and stunning views of the Bay Area without having to pay hefty entrance fees.
4. Hayward Area Historical Society:Learn about the history of Hayward at the Hayward Area Historical Society for a suggested donation. Discover local artifacts, exhibitions, and stories that showcase the heritage of the area.
5. Hayward Shoreline Interpretive Center:Visit the Hayward Shoreline Interpretive Center to explore exhibits on local wildlife, ecology, and conservation efforts. Admission is free, making it a budget-friendly educational experience for all ages.

Exploring Hayward's Hidden Gems
Are you ready to uncover some of Hayward's best-kept secrets? From local eateries to scenic spots, here are a few hidden gems you should definitely check out:
1. Eddy's BakeryIf you have a sweet tooth, you must visit Eddy's Bakery. This family-owned bakery offers delicious pastries, cakes, and bread at affordable prices. Don't miss their famous almond croissants!
2. The Bodega CafeFor a cozy brunch or lunch spot, head to The Bodega Cafe. This charming cafe serves up tasty sandwiches, salads, and coffee in a relaxed atmosphere. Try their avocado toast!
3. Sulphur Creek Nature CenterWant to connect with nature? Visit the Sulphur Creek Nature Center. This hidden gem is home to injured and orphaned native wildlife. You can explore nature trails and learn about local animals for free!
4. Stonebrae Country ClubFor breathtaking views of the Bay Area, head to Stonebrae Country Club. This exclusive club offers a public restaurant with panoramic views. Treat yourself to a meal while enjoying the stunning scenery.

Local Etiquette Tips for Hayward
Greetings: In Hayward, people are generally friendly and appreciate a polite greeting. When meeting someone for the first time, a simple "hello" or "hi" is appropriate. Tipping: Tipping is customary in Hayward, especially in restaurants and for services like taxis or haircuts. It's standard to tip around 15-20% of the total bill. Dining: When dining out, it's polite to wait to be seated by the host or hostess. Refrain from placing your elbows on the table while eating, and always say "please" and "thank you" to the servers. Punctuality: Being on time is important in Hayward, whether it's for a meeting, social gathering, or appointment. Make sure to arrive promptly to show respect for others' time. Public Behavior: Respect for personal space and others' privacy is valued in Hayward. Avoid loud or disruptive behavior in public places, and always ask for permission before taking someone's photo. Thank You Notes: Sending a thank you note or email after receiving a gift or hospitality is a thoughtful gesture appreciated in Hayward. It shows gratitude and good manners. Remember, these are just general guidelines, and individual preferences may vary.
